The plant is supplied by Northern Ireland-based CDE, which has North American ... Harford County is mostly underlain by complex igneous and metamorphic rocks of the Piedmont Province. This includes schists, gneiss and amphibolites of metasedimentary and metavolcanic origin, various granites and rocks of the Cambrian Baltimore Mafic Complex. All of the Piedmont rocks were caught up and deformed in the Ordovician Taconic Orogeny.
